Abstract :
Security threats such as denial-of-service attacks can slow down, or in the worst case, paralyze a big part of the network and cause limited availability of service. This can result in loss of revenue and can badly damage the reputation of the service provider. Other drivers for security are eNodeB spoofing and unauthorized access to network equipment meant to disturb or steal network capacity. This paper describes LTE transport network with a security solution for mitigating and reducing the number of security threats. Specifications by 3GPP standard are achieved by using the widely recognized IPsec technology and PKI infrastructure.
